"Robigus" meaning in Latin

See Robigus in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Proper name

IPA: /roːˈbiː.ɡus/ [Classical], [roːˈbiːɡʊs̠] [Classical], /roˈbi.ɡus/ (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ical), [roˈbiːɡus] (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ical)
Etymology: From rōbīgō (“rust; blight”).   1. (Roman mythology) The god summoned against the blight Tags: Roman, declension-2 Categories (topical): Roman deities Derived forms: Rōbīgālia
